The Loose Dogs formed in Tokyo in 2015 around vocalist Riyu Kosaka and guitarist Shota Tanaka, with bassist Tomohiro Kinoshita and drummer Yuji Otsuka rounding out the lineup. They started playing underground venues, developing a sound that didn't fit neatly into established categories.

In 2017, their single 'Ame Nochi Niji Iro' broke through to wider recognition. The band kept writing material like 'One Day' and 'Yoru ni nareba' that maintained this raw, conversational quality.

They've continued releasing music that blends rock energy with pop structures and folk storytelling. The work stays grounded in the same emotional territory that first defined them, avoiding polish in favor of immediacy.
